“We are always haunted by the idea that we could have worked harder or done better. But that is our human condition.”

Sigmund Freud

Simplified Meaning:

People often feel like they should have tried harder or done a better job. This feeling is very common and a natural part of being human. For instance, think about a student who gets a good grade on a test but still wonders if they could have studied more to get an even higher grade. This feeling is normal and almost everyone experiences it at some point. It shows that we always want to improve and do our best. However, it's important not to be too hard on yourself because doing your best at that moment is what matters most. Instead of stressing too much about what you could have done better, use that feeling to motivate yourself to keep improving in the future.
